Palestine - Total Lower Secondary Education Gross Enrolment Ratio
Since 2009, Palestine Total Lower Secondary Education Gross Enrolment Ratio was down by 0.8points year on year. In 2014, the country was number 90 among other countries in Total Lower Secondary Education Gross Enrolment Ratio at 86.89 Percent. Palestine is overtaken by Moldova, which was ranked number 89 with 87.04 Percent and is followed by Dominican Republic at 86.68 Percent. Belgium ranked the highest with 180.38 Percent in 2014, that is a fall of 0.1points versus 2013. Netherlands, Costa Rica and Thailand resp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Burundi recorded the best 5 years average growth at +13.6points per year, while Saint Lucia was the worst growing country at -3.3points per year.
